Soubor s příponou EFI je soubor Extensible Firmware Interface.
Jsou to spustitelné soubory zavaděče, existují v počítačových systémech založených na UEFI (Unified Extensible Firmware Interface) a obsahují data o tom, jak by měl proces zavádění pokračovat.
Alfred Pasieka / Getty Images
Soubory EFI lze otevírat pomocí EFI Developer Kit a Microsoft EFI Utilities, ale upřímně řečeno, pokud nejste vývojářem hardwaru, jejich „otevírání“ má jen malé využití.
Kde je soubor EFI ve Windows?
V systému s nainstalovaným operačním systémem bude mít správce spouštění, který existuje jako součást firmwaru UEFI základní desky, umístění souboru EFI uložené v proměnné BootOrder. Může to být ve skutečnosti jiný správce zavádění, pokud máte nainstalovaný nástroj pro více zavádění, ale obvykle jde pouze o zavaděč EFI pro váš operační systém.
Většinou je tento soubor uložen ve speciálním systémovém oddílu EFI. Tento oddíl je obvykle skrytý a nemá písmeno jednotky.
V systému UEFI s nainstalovaným Windows 10 bude například soubor EFI umístěn v následujícím umístění na tomto skrytém oddílu:
EFI boot bootx64.efi
or
EFI boot bootia32.efi
Soubor bootx64.efi uvidíte, pokud máte nainstalovanou 64bitovou verzi systému Windows, nebo soubor bootia32.efi, pokud používáte 32bitovou verzi. Viz 64bitová a 32bitová verze: Jaký je rozdíl? pokud si nejste jisti, získáte další informace.
V některých počítačích se systémem Windows funguje soubor winload.efi jako zavaděč a je obvykle uložen v následujícím umístění:
C: Windows System32 Boot winload.efi
Pokud je váš systémový disk něco jiného než C nebo je Windows nainstalován do jiné složky než Windows, pak se samozřejmě bude lišit přesná cesta v počítači.
V systému bez nainstalovaného operačního systému s prázdnou proměnnou BootOrder hledá správce spouštění základní desky na předem určených místech soubor EFI, například na discích v optických jednotkách a na jiných připojených médiích. K tomu dochází, protože pokud je toto pole prázdné, nemáte nainstalovaný funkční operační systém, takže pravděpodobně budete instalovat další.
Například na instalačním DVD nebo ISO obrazu Windows 10 existují následující dva soubory, které správce spouštění UEFI vašeho počítače rychle najde:
D: efi boot bootx64.efi
a
D: efi boot bootia32.efi
Stejně jako u instalační jednotky Windows a cesty shora se bude jednotka lišit v závislosti na zdroji médií. V tomto případě je D písmeno přiřazené mé optické jednotce. Kromě toho, jak jste si možná všimli, jsou na instalačním médiu zahrnuty zavaděče EFI 64bitové i 32bitové. Důvodem je, že instalační disk obsahuje oba typy architektury jako možnosti instalace.
Kde je soubor v jiných operačních systémech?
Zde jsou některá výchozí umístění souborů EFI pro některé operační systémy jiné než Windows:
macOS používá tento soubor jako zavaděč, ale ne ve všech situacích:
System Library CoreServices boot.efi
Zavaděč EFI pro Linux se bude lišit v závislosti na nainstalované distribuci, ale zde je několik:
EFI SuSE elilo.efi
EFI RedHat elilo.efi
EFI human elilo.efi
Získáte ten nápad.
Stále nemůžete soubor otevřít nebo použít?
Vezměte na vědomí, že existují některé typy souborů, které jsou velmi podobné pravidlu „.EFI“, které byste skutečně mohli mít a můžete je tedy otevřít pomocí běžného softwarového programu. To je s největší pravděpodobností případ, pokud jste jednoduše nesprávně přečetli příponu souboru.
Například můžete mít skutečně soubor dokumentu faxu EFX eFax, který nemá nic společného se soubory rozhraní Extensible Firmware Interface a je místo toho dokumentem, který se otevře pomocí faxové služby. Nebo váš soubor možná používá příponu souboru .EFL a jedná se o soubor v externím formátu nebo o šifrovaný soubor Encryptafile.
Pokud jste si jisti, že můžete otevřít soubor, který máte, pravděpodobně to není ve stejném formátu, který je popsán na této stránce. Místo toho dvakrát zkontrolujte příponu souboru a prozkoumejte program, který jej může otevřít nebo jej převést do nového formátu.
Můžete dokonce zkusit nahrát do služby převaděče souborů, jako je Zamzar, abyste zjistili, zda rozpozná typ souboru a navrhne formát převodu.